Abstract

In this paper, we identify the basic variables to build solar power plant using methods MCDM FOR Ranking in the country for the construction of solar power plant deal.THE topsis method Each of the numeric distance from the ideal option in terms of positive and negative attributes. Then, using data envelopment analysis And using a multiple model CCR and according to the output topsis method As well as input variables every city in the country to assess relative Solar power plant construction or in other words the capacity to build solar power plant In each of the cities we compare the relative efficiency and obtains points.Revealing the efficient frontier are Pareto efficient cities for investment and the construction and operation of solar power offer.
